Summary

  • Évian summit talks centered on Donald Trump’s newly announced 60-day Iran-US ceasefire, with G7 leaders demanding details on how the framework would actually be carried out.
  • A page-and-a-half memorandum, described by Vice-President JD Vance as very general, leaves key questions unresolved on oil-market stability, Lebanon’s sovereignty and preventing an Iranian nuclear weapon.
  • Trump arrived needing a diplomatic win after the US and Israel attacked Tehran and after allies largely refused to join the war, a conflict that has driven fuel costs, food shortages and market turmoil.
  • European leaders are now more willing to confront him publicly, carrying grievances over tariffs, NATO and the economic fallout from Hormuz disruptions into what analysts expect to be a frank, potentially combustible summit.
  • The White House expects the next phase of Iran negotiations to take several weeks, leaving the summit to test whether allies accept Trump’s victory narrative or challenge it.

US-Iran Tentative Peace Deal 2026: Strait of Hormuz Reopens Amid Fragile Ceasefire and Unresolved Nuclear Tensions

Overview

On June 15, 2026, a tentative peace deal was announced between the US and Iran, aiming to ease tensions and address urgent maritime security issues. Central to the agreement is the reopening of the Strait of Hormuz, a vital route for about 20% of the world’s oil supply, which had been nearly shut down after Iran asserted control in late February. The US accused Iran of laying mines, leading to a blockade of Iranian ports. The deal’s immediate focus is restoring oil flow and reducing global economic risks, marking a crucial step toward de-escalation and renewed diplomatic engagement.
